Photo: ‘Welcome Babyboy’ – Cenk Tosun Reacts To Scoring Everton Goal In First Game Back Following Birth Of His Son

Everton recorded their third win in a row beating Crystal Palace 2-0 on Sunday in the Premier League.

Turkey international Cenk Tosun came off the bench to score the Toffees second goal.

The goal held added significance to the striker as he scored on his first game back since the birth of his son Arden Cenk Tosun.

The 27-year-old shared a photograph on his Instagram account doing the baby – or cradle – celebration following the goal.

Tosun then went onto explain exactly why it was such a special goal for him in his own words.
